Found the direct quote:
"Update: Just looked at window sticker for my 69 RAIV firebird. First cost option is : 347 Firebird RAm Air cosists of 4 bbl 400 ram air eng ,hood ram air inlet - chrome rocker covers & oil cap -dual exhaust ,heavy duty battery -f 70 x14 red or white stripe tires -unless other optional equip. specified. code 347 $850.99
Then near the bottom of another 23 options there is listed : Hood Ram Air Inlet code 611 $ 84.26 Looks like a case of double dipping to me!"
